What You'll Need for Best Fresh Cucumber Tomato Feta Salad in 10 Minutes
Choosing the right ingredients makes a big difference, but this recipe is forgiving enough to work with what you have.
- 1 large cucumber
- 2 cups cherry tomatoes
- 1/2 cup crumbled feta
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 3 tbsp red wine vinegar
- 1 tsp dried o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Optional: Fresh basil leaves
- Optional: Red onion slices

π Ingredient Notes
- cucumber: Use a mandoline for thin, even slices.
- red wine vinegar: White wine vinegar or lemon juice can be substituted.

How to Make Best Fresh Cucumber Tomato Feta Salad in 10 Minutes
- Slice cucumber: Using a mandoline or sharp knife, slice the cucumber into thin half-moons.
- Halve tomatoes: Cut the cherry tomatoes in half.
- Mix dressing: In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, red wine vinegar, oregano, salt, and pepper.
- Toss salad: In a large bowl, combine cucumber, tomatoes, and feta. Pour dressing over the top and toss to coat.
- Serve: Serve immediately, garnished with fresh basil and red onion slices if desired.
Cook's Tips for Perfect Best Fresh Cucumber Tomato Feta Salad in 10 Minutes
- Common mistake and fix: Don't over-dress the salad. Start with less dressing and add more if needed to prevent a soggy salad.
